Partager via


SERIAL_BAUD_RATE structure (ntddser.h)

La structure SERIAL_BAUD_RATE spécifie la vitesse en bauds à laquelle un port série est actuellement configuré pour transmettre et recevoir des données.

Syntaxe

typedef struct _SERIAL_BAUD_RATE {
  ULONG BaudRate;
} SERIAL_BAUD_RATE, *PSERIAL_BAUD_RATE;

Membres

BaudRate

Vitesse en bauds. Ce paramètre spécifie le nombre de bits par seconde qu’un port série est actuellement configuré pour transmettre ou recevoir. Par exemple, une valeur BaudRate de 115200 indique que le port est configuré pour transférer 115 200 bits par seconde.

Remarques

Les IOCTL_SERIAL_GET_BAUD_RATE et IOCTL_SERIAL_SET_BAUD_RATE demandes de contrôle d’E/S utilisent la structure SERIAL_BAUD_RATE pour spécifier le débit en bauds d’un port série. La demande IOCTL_SERIAL_SET_BAUD_RATE configure un port série pour qu’il fonctionne à une vitesse de bauds spécifiée. La requête IOCTL_SERIAL_GET_BAUD_RATE interroge un port série pour connaître le taux de bauds sur lequel il est actuellement configuré pour fonctionner.

Pour plus d’informations sur certaines des fréquences de bauds possibles qu’un pilote de contrôleur série peut prendre en charge, consultez la description du membre MaxBaud dans SERIAL_COMMPROP.

Configuration requise

Condition requise Valeur
Client minimal pris en charge Pris en charge à partir de Windows 2000.
En-tête ntddser.h

Voir aussi

IOCTL_SERIAL_GET_BAUD_RATE

IOCTL_SERIAL_SET_BAUD_RATE

SERIAL_COMMPROP